A Facile Method for Removal of Methylene Blue Dye from Wastewater Using Biochar-Modified Chitosan Beads

Dyes play a major role in industry but when used in excess or not treated properly may get discharged into water sources causing toxic effects on human consumption. Various methods have been reported for the removal of these dyes from water sources in which adsorption has proved to be a simple and efficient method. Chitosan is a biodegradable polymer and is an environmentally friendly and sustainable substance which when mixed with biochar, has proved to be a successful technique for dye removal. In this paper, the preparation of chitosan beads using biochar has been described along with characterization like SEM and FTIR data. The parameters for adsorption have been optimized and it was discovered that it adhered to pseudo-first-order kinetics and the Langmuir adsorption isotherm. The results obtained showed that the method could be used for removal of this dye from contaminated water sources.
